精彩评论



随着人工智能技术的发展脚本的应用变得越来越广泛。无论是设计软件中的自动化工具还是数据分析和应对进展中的辅助程序脚本都发挥着关键作用。本文将带领大家从基础概念入手逐步深入到高级应用通过一系列详细的操作指南帮助大家掌握脚本的采用方法。
在开始学习脚本之前咱们需要保障已经具备了必要的基础知识和准备工作。理解若干基本概念是非常要紧的。脚本是一种用于自动化施行任务的程序代码它可以通过预设的指令来实现特定功能。这些功能可以包含数据解决、图形生成、文本分析等。
咱们需要准备若干必要的工具和资源。你需要一个文本编辑器或IDE(集成开发环境)例如Sublime Text、Visual Studio Code或是说PyCharm。你需要安装相关的编程语言环境比如Python、JavaScript或Ruby等。还需要按照具体的脚本需求安装相应的库或框架。
在准备好工具和资源之后,咱们就可开始编写脚本了。这里以Python为例,介绍怎样编写和调试脚本。
假设我们要编写一个简单的Python脚本来实现对一组数据的应对。我们需要创建一个新的Python文件,例如`data_processing.py`。 在这个文件中,我们可编写如下代码:
```python
# data_processing.py
def process_data(data):
processed_data = [x * 2 for x in data]
return processed_data
if __name__ == __mn__:
data = [1, 2, 3, 4, 5]
result = process_data(data)
print(Processed Data:, result)
```
这段代码定义了一个函数`process_data`,用于对输入的数据实施应对。在这个例子中我们只是简单地将每个元素乘以2。在`if __name__ == __mn__:`块中,我们调用这个函数并打印结果。
编写完脚本后,我们需要对其实行调试。Python提供了若干内置的调试工具,例如断点和打印语句。我们能够在需要检查的地方插入断点,或采用`print`语句输出变量的值。例如,在上面的例子中,我们可添加如下代码:
```python
print(Input Data:, data)
```
这行代码将在施行到该行时输出输入数据的值,有助于我们理解数据是不是正确传递给函数。
现在我们已经掌握了基本的脚本编写和调试技巧,接下来我们将探讨脚本在实际应用中的具体场景。
脚本在文本分析方面有着广泛的应用。例如,我们可采用Python编写脚本来提取文档中的关键词。这里以NLTK库为例,介绍怎么样实现这一功能。
我们需要安装NLTK库。在命令行中运行以下命令:
```bash
pip install nltk
```
我们能够编写如下的脚本:
```python
import nltk
from nltk.corpus import stopwords
from nltk.tokenize import word_tokenize
nltk.download('punkt')
nltk.download('stopwords')
def extract_keywords(text):
words = word_tokenize(text)
stop_words = set(stopwords.words('english'))
filtered_words = [word for word in words if word.lower() not in stop_words]
return filtered_words
if __name__ == __mn__:
text = Artificial intelligence is a wonderful field that combines computer science and data analysis.
keywords = extract_keywords(text)
print(Keywords:, keywords)
```
在这段代码中,我们首先导入了NLTK库,并了必要的数据集。 我们定义了一个函数`extract_keywords`,用于提取文本中的关键词。在主函数中,我们调用了这个函数并打印出结果。
脚本在图形生成方面也有着广泛的应用。例如,我们可采用Python的matplotlib库来绘制图表。这里以绘制柱状图为例,介绍怎样去实现这一功能。
我们需要安装matplotlib库。在命令行中运行以下命令:
```bash
pip install matplotlib
```
我们能够编写如下的脚本:
```python
import matplotlib.pyplot as plt
def plot_bar_chart(data):
plt.bar(range(len(data)), data)
plt.xlabel('Index')
plt.ylabel('Value')
plt.title('Bar Chart Example')
plt.show()
if __name__ == __mn__:
data = [10, 20, 30, 40, 50]
plot_bar_chart(data)
```
在这段代码中,我们首先导入了matplotlib库。 我们定义了一个函数`plot_bar_chart`,用于绘制柱状图。在主函数中,我们调用了这个函数并传入数据。
在掌握了基本的脚本编写和调试技巧之后,我们就能够开始探索脚本的高级应用了。在这里,我们将介绍若干实战案例,帮助大家更好地理解和应用脚本。
在实行数据分析之前,往往需要对原始数据实施清洗和预解决。脚本能够帮助我们高效地完成这一任务。例如,我们可采用Python的pandas库来读取和解决CSV文件。这里以清洗CSV文件为例,介绍怎么样实现这一功能。
我们需要安装pandas库。在命令行中运行以下命令:
```bash
pip install pandas
```
我们能够编写如下的脚本:
```python
import pandas as pd
def clean_csv(file_path):
df = pd.read_csv(file_path)
return df
if __name__ == __mn__:
file_path = 'data.csv'
cleaned_df = clean_csv(file_path)
print(cleaned_df.head())
```
在这段代码中,我们首先导入了pandas库。 我们定义了一个函数`clean_csv`,用于清洗CSV文件。在主函数中,我们调用了这个函数并传入文件路径。
在软件开发期间,自动化测试是非常要紧的一环。脚本能够帮助我们高效地完成自动化测试任务。例如我们可采用Python的unittest库来编写自动化测试脚本。这里以编写自动化测试脚本为例,介绍怎样去实现这一功能。
我们需要安装unittest库。在命令行中运行以下命令:
```bash
pip install unittest
```
我们可编写如下的脚本:
```python
import unittest
class TestMathOperations(unittest.TestCase):
def test_addition(self):
self.assertEqual(add(1, 2), 3)
def test_subtraction(self):
self.assertEqual(subtract(5, 2), 3)
def add(a, b):
return a b
def subtract(a, b):
return a - b
if __name__ == '__mn__':
unittest.mn()
```
在这段代码中,我们首先导入了unittest库。 我们定义了一个测试类`TestMathOperations`,用于测试数学运算。在主函数中,我们调用了`unittest.mn()`来运行测试。
通过本文的学习,相信大家已经掌握了脚本的基础知识和高级应用。脚本不仅可增强我们的工作效率,还能够帮助我们更好地理解和解决数据。在未来,随着技术的不断发展,脚本的应用领域将会更加广泛。期望大家能够继续深入学习和探索,不断拓展本人的技能边界。
建议大家多实践、多思考。只有不断地动手操作和思考难题,才能真正掌握脚本的精髓。期望本文能为大家的学习之路提供一定的帮助。